From HYGEIA to Maternl

HYGEIA became the Hygeia Foundation, Inc., an IRS-approved 501(c)(3) that endures today as Hope After Loss, with its own boards and continuing mission. Maternl now carries that vision forward — extending a proven model of trust and compassion into a scalable, multilingual, AI-enabled platform for maternal and newborn health worldwide.
